Belgium - Number of Persons Employed in Air Transport
Since 2014, Belgium Number of Persons Employed in Air Transport increased 2.2% year on year. With 5.9 Thousand Persons in 2019, the country was number 15 among other countries in Number of Persons Employed in Air Transport. Belgium is overtaken by Austria, which was number 14 with 8.86 Thousand Persons and is followed by Norway with 5.8 Thousand Persons. United States topped the ranking with 505 Thousand Persons in 2019, -0.8%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, Germany and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Estonia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+14.9% per year, while Lithuania was the worst growing country at -5.6% per year.
